Elementary\, but very useful lemma due to Biernacki and Krzyz (1955) asserts that the ratio of two power series inherits monotonicity from that of the sequence of ratios of their corresponding coefficients. Over the last two decades it has been realized that\, under some additional assumptions\, similar claims hold for more general series ratios and integral transforms as well as for unimodality in place of monotonicity. In the talk\, we discuss conditions on the functional sequence and the kernel of an integral transform ensuring such property. Numerous series and integral transforms appearing in applications satisfy our sufficient conditions\, including Dirichlet\, factorial and inverse factorial series\, Laplace\, Mellin and generalized Stieltjes transforms\, among many others. The key role in our considerations is played by the notion of sign regularity. \n\n

Theoretically\, it can be treated as maximum likelihood estimator of unknown vector parameter of multidimensional linear system (MLS) model with one input and m outputs.  Practically important and non-trivial case is considered\, when the number of nuisance parameters\, which are values of input deterministic signal\, tends to infinity. Under assumptions that MLS output signals distorted by random Gaussian stationary  EMBED Equation.DSMT4 -dimensional noise with known matrix power spectrum and the likelihood function of observations satisfies the conditions of local asymptotic normality\, the analytical form of limiting covariance matrix of the Capon’s estimate is given.Steered response power phase alignment algorithm (SRP-PHAT) is devoted to subclass of so called phase-based robust estimators. Mathematical basis of SRP-PHAT estimator shows its applicability to small-aperture seismic array data to solve two different tasks: frequency-wavenumber analyses and seismic source localization problems. Several experiments with real data demonstrate its advantage compared to conventional methods that are involved in most of free and commercial seismological software.
